Woolly winner revealed as British Wool's 'Sheep of the Year' 2025

Voters were asked to choose from 12 fleecy contenders each representing the diversity and charm of the UK’s native breeds

British Wool has unveiled its 2025 Sheep of the Year as the Black Wensleydales and Zwartbles in Hampshire captured by Charlie Dodd (Instagram @smallholder_farm_girl). READ MORE: Little Bo Peep leads...
